The first full-length collaboration between producer/vocalist Palien and prolific rapper Tommy Moom$ is here.
VERCETTI features all-original production by Palien. The 14-track album covers a whiplash-inducing array of sounds and themes, delivered through a rapidfire collision of perspectives and styles.
Inspired by the neon sunsets and eclectic sounds of the classic 2002 video game Grand Theft Auto: Vice City, the album pits Palien and Tommy Moom$ against each other, battling over the mic like two brothers wrestling over a PS2 controller.
And just like if Vice City’s cult hero protagonist Tommy Vercetti was being controlled by two rivals fighting over the buttons, the spirit of each track ricochets between extremes – all depending on who’s got a grip on the verse.
Made on an OG SP-404, an EP-1320, some cheap mics and a couple kebabs – and brother, that's what it sounds like.
